When the server is started, and the DES plugin is enabled, it searches all the backends for DES passwords to convert to AES. This search is typically unindexed, and on large databases/backends this takes a long time and the start script time's out.
We need to come up with a better way to handle this. Perhaps only run it on cn=config when starting the server? And/or add a new task to convert DES passwords to AES for specific backends(filter/scope)?
